These ARP Replies are dropped instead. This however defeats the purpose of the DHCPACK snooping, for instance. Right now, a DAT entry in the DHT will be purged every five minutes, likely leading to a mesh-wide ARP Request broadcast after this timeout. Which then recreates the entry. The idea of the DHCPACK snooping is to be able to update an entry before a timeout happens, to avoid ARP Request flooding. This patch fixes this issue by updating a DAT entry on incoming ARP Replies even if a matching DAT entry already exists. While still filtering the ARP Reply towards the soft-interface, to avoid duplicate messages on the client device side. Signed-off-by: Linus Lüssing Acked-by: Antonio Quartulli --- This patch was verified in VMs via gratuitous ARP Replies generated by "mausezahn", together with the "batman-adv: allow snooping gratuitous ARP Replies" patch. Before this patch, the timeout observed via "batctl dc" would continue to increase on gratuitous ARP Reply reception.
